Lupita Nyong’o took home the Academy Award for best supporting actress Sunday night — but not without a battle.

The Kenyan-born actress scored an Oscar for her first big movie role and beat out fellow nominees including actress Jennifer Lawrence — however, there seemed to be no hard feelings from the American Hustle star.

Lawrence gave Nyong’o a standing ovation — along with the rest of the crowd — and seemed genuinely happy when the 12 Years a Slave was awarded the Oscar.

She later met with Nyong’o backstage after the ceremony and pretended to wrestle Nyong’o in an amusing photo that captured the comical personalities of the A-list stars.
